This was largely a repercussion of the advent of radio and television reporting, which brought news bulletins to the public with a rate that the press could not wish to match. To hold their target market, papers provided raising quantities of expository materialarticles on the background of the information, character sketches, and columns of timely comment by authors experienced in offering point of view in understandable kind.


In nations with communist governments, journalism was owned by the state, and reporters and editors were federal government staff members. Under such a system, the prime feature of the press to report the news was integrated with the task to maintain and sustain the national ideology and the declared goals of the state. American journalism encounters a confluence of obstacles that present the most profound risk to the cost-free press in even more than a century. News companies are shrinking and dying under sustained economic pressure.


Freedom is the significantly opposed journalistic dedication to complying with facts wherever they lead. It positions the truthand the search for it with an open yet unconvinced mindabove all else. Those might seem like blandly acceptable clichs of Journalism 101, but in this hyperpolarized age, independent journalism and the in some cases counterintuitive values that stimulate it have become a radical quest.


It requires that we show the globe as it is, not the world as we might desire it to be. It requires journalists to be ready to exonerate somebody deemed a bad guy or question someone considered as a hero. It firmly insists on sharing what we learnfully and fairlyregardless of whom it might distress or what the political effects may be.
